Roast Beef Quiche
- 1 unbaked pastry shell (9 inches)
- 1-3/4 cups finely chopped cooked roast beef
- 1/4 cup chopped green onions
- 1 tablespoon all-purpose flour
- 4 large eggs
- 1/2 cup evaporated milk
- 1 tablespoon steak sauce
- 1/8 teaspoon each dill weed, dried basil and dried oregano
- Salt and pepper to taste
- 2 cups shredded cheddar cheese
- 1/2 cup chopped green pepper
- Line unpricked pastry shell with a double thickness of heavy-duty foil. Bake at 450u0b0 for 5 minutes; remove foil. Bake 5 minutes longer. Reduce heat to 375u0b0. Sprinkle beef and onions into the crust.
- In a bowl, beat the flour and eggs until smooth. Add milk, steak sauce and seasonings; beat until smooth. Stir in cheese and green pepper. Pour into crust.
- Bake for 25 minutes or until center is set. Let stand for 10 minutes before cutting.
